Transaction 99e680287734994d10d4d2767b3c2b313964018ac64673aaa589d05a8eb87eee

22 Input
2 Outputs
  • 99e680287734994d10d4d2767b3c2b313964018ac64673aaa589d05a8eb87eee:0
  • value  3851315
    address  32KK3D6F3GpXwNNZ9c14HVnHjBNvSoJPDu
  • 99e680287734994d10d4d2767b3c2b313964018ac64673aaa589d05a8eb87eee:1
  • value  130000000
    address  34MkGAEeinMEypMAuQBAYyLguRHwrps47n